2) Road to Hana

The Road to Hana is an adventure you won’t want to miss during your visit to Maui. This iconic drive takes you along the eastern coast of the island, through lush rainforests, towering cliffs, and breathtaking waterfalls. Strap in and get ready for a journey that will leave you in awe.

As you wind your way along the Road to Hana, you’ll be met with jaw-dropping beauty at every turn. You’ll pass by cascading waterfalls, like the famous Twin Falls and the stunning Wailua Falls. Be sure to bring your camera, as these sights are truly postcard-worthy.

But it’s not just the waterfalls that make this drive so special. The road itself is a marvel, with hairpin turns, narrow bridges, and dramatic cliffs. Take your time and soak in the beauty around you as you navigate the twists and turns of this scenic drive.

Along the way, you’ll also encounter lush rainforests, vibrant floral displays, and stunning coastal views. Stop off at the Waianapanapa State Park to explore the black sand beach and visit the beautiful sea caves. Or take a dip in the pools at Oheo Gulch, known as the Seven Sacred Pools, where freshwater streams cascade down into the ocean.

7) Molokini Crater

Molokini Crater is a must-visit destination for any lover of underwater exploration. This partially submerged volcanic crater is located just off the coast of Maui and offers a unique and unforgettable experience. The waters surrounding the crater are home to an incredible array of marine life, making it a snorkeler’s paradise.

Hop on a boat trip and make your way to Molokini Crater, where you’ll be greeted by crystal-clear waters and vibrant coral reefs. As you dive beneath the surface, you’ll be transported to a world filled with colorful tropical fish, graceful manta rays, and even the occasional Hawaiian green sea turtle. The visibility in these waters is unparalleled, allowing you to fully appreciate the beauty that lies beneath.

Whether you’re an experienced snorkeler or a first-timer, Molokini Crater has something for everyone. Snorkeling gear can be rented on the boat, and friendly guides are available to ensure you have a safe and enjoyable experience. Take your time exploring the different areas of the crater, each offering its own unique marine life and underwater landscapes.

For an even more immersive experience, consider taking a scuba diving excursion to Molokini Crater. Dive deeper and discover hidden caves, swim-throughs, and the fascinating volcanic formations that make this crater so special. With professional dive instructors by your side, you’ll be able to explore the depths of Molokini in a safe and thrilling manner.

9) Makawao Town

Welcome to Makawao Town, a charming and picturesque town that offers a unique and authentic Maui experience. Located upcountry, Makawao Town is known for its laid-back atmosphere, rich history, and vibrant arts scene. As you stroll through the streets, you’ll be greeted by colorful storefronts, local boutiques, and charming art galleries. 

Makawao Town is famous for its paniolo (Hawaiian cowboy) heritage, and you’ll find remnants of this culture throughout the town. Visit the Makawao Rodeo, held annually on the 4th of July, and experience the excitement of bull riding, barrel racing, and other rodeo events. 

One of the highlights of Makawao Town is its thriving arts community. Browse through the many galleries and witness the creativity and talent of local artists. From paintings to sculptures to handcrafted jewelry, you’re sure to find a unique piece of art to take home as a memento of your time in Maui.

When it comes to dining, Makawao Town offers a variety of delicious options. Sample local flavors at one of the charming cafes or try the mouthwatering dishes at the town’s restaurants. From Hawaiian fusion cuisine to international flavors, there’s something to satisfy every palate.

Escape the hustle and bustle of the tourist hotspots and discover the hidden gem that is Makawao Town. Immerse yourself in its relaxed atmosphere, explore its charming streets, and experience the unique and authentic side of Maui.
